Abstract
Hypertension is a complex syndrome comprised of many systemic abnormalities and life-threatening complications. The importance of factors other than blood pressure is underscored by numerous studies and by the lack of physician interest in blood pressure measurement. We therefore investigated the possibility of detecting hypertension without any reference to blood pressure measurement. Preliminary results suggest that such detection is technically possible and medically necessary
